Subject: Intern cohort arriving Monday

Facilities,

Twelve interns from the Bramleigh programme arrive Monday 08:30 at Thistledown House reception. Badges are printed; lanyards are not — please stock the front desk by Friday. They'll be escorted to floor 3 in two groups. Desk allocations are on the shared tracker. One escort pass is needed for the group lead until individual badges activate; use the code below.

turnstile pass: bdg-FVNQRS-72965873

Subject: Circuit breaker for Orchardline upstream — ready for review

Team, the new breaker wraps all calls to the Orchardline pricing API. It trips after five consecutive failures, holds open for thirty seconds, then half-opens with a single probe. Thresholds live in config, not code, so ops can tune without a redeploy. Please review the fallback path carefully — stale-cache reads are now the default. The candidate build is tagged with the token below.

pipeline stamp: htk31_f769b577b3028a4e9958e5bb8d1259a

This adds a k6-style scenario that exercises the full checkout path — cart, payment intent, confirmation — against the staging cluster. It ramps virtual users in stages, holds a plateau, then ramps down, with per-endpoint latency thresholds that fail the run on breach. Results land in the usual dashboard. Nothing in production code changes; this is test-only. Reviewers: please sanity-check the stage durations and failure thresholds rather than the plumbing. The stage parameters are defined as follows.

constants for kageg-bawif:
QUOTAS = {
    "quenwyn": 1,
    "oliix": 10,
}